WebThere are many variables for non-EU citizens applying for residency and a Carte de Séjour in France. These depend on the purpose for stay (employment, study or retirement), duration of planned stay, available finances and many other factors. Details on application requirements are available from the French Embassy in the home country. WebFor any stay in France exceeding 90 days, you are required to apply in advance for a long-stay vis. In this instance your nationality does not exempt you from requirements. …

WebJun 15, 2024 · Unless you obtained a VLS-TS, the visa de long séjour does not give you permission to live in France—it gives you permission to apply for the carte de séjour. If your visa has the words "carte de séjour à solliciter,” you do need to get a residence permit. Start that process within two months of your arrival, at the prefecture of your ... WebMar 14, 2024 · The French healthcare system and health insurance. France has a universal public healthcare system known as protection universelle maladie (PUMa).In 2016, PUMa replaced France’s previous healthcare system, couverture universelle maladie (CMU), both simplifying coverage and extending service to even more residents.
